I scatter copies of this timetable all over my life. I have one at my bedside, another by the fireplace, and a third on my desk, and whenever I think about it, I decide that it’s time for me to order the latest edition, which comes with maps and timetables for most trains (and many ferries) on the planet. It used to be called Cook’s Timetable, and it came in a European and International edition. But since 2014, John Potter and his intrepid rail group in Peterborough have brought out the print timetable in one edition, which is perfect…
